From 1a50b24d69284afbb03c0c9d8fc5ea186edf75f4 Mon Sep 17 00:00:00 2001 From: doublekou <951513186@qq.com> Date: Wed, 11 Oct 2023 14:35:17 +0800 Subject: [PATCH] =?UTF-8?q?=E6=96=B0=E5=A2=9E=E4=B8=8D=E5=90=8C=E7=B1=BB?= =?UTF-8?q?=E5=9E=8B=E5=AE=A2=E6=88=B7?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/api/geopoliticalCustomers/types.ts | 1 + .../geopoliticalCustomers.vue | 11 + .../geopoliticalCustomersModal copy.vue | 2289 +++++++++++++++++ .../geopoliticalCustomersModal.vue | 1244 +++++---- 4 files changed, 3025 insertions(+), 520 deletions(-) create mode 100644 src/views/geopoliticalCustomers/geopoliticalCustomersModal copy.vue diff --git a/src/api/geopoliticalCustomers/types.ts b/src/api/geopoliticalCustomers/types.ts index 9384f59..9c63e55 100644 --- a/src/api/geopoliticalCustomers/types.ts +++ b/src/api/geopoliticalCustomers/types.ts @@ -173,6 +173,7 @@ interface customStoreEntitiesItem { disabled?: boolean } export interface CustomerDTO { + customType?: number | undefined customId?: number | undefined //客户名称 customName?: string | undefined diff --git a/src/views/geopoliticalCustomers/geopoliticalCustomers.vue b/src/views/geopoliticalCustomers/geopoliticalCustomers.vue index 2747295..c334dce 100644 --- a/src/views/geopoliticalCustomers/geopoliticalCustomers.vue +++ b/src/views/geopoliticalCustomers/geopoliticalCustomers.vue @@ -121,6 +121,17 @@ const columns: ProColumns[] = [ title: '客户名称', dataIndex: 'customName' }, + { + title: '客户类型', + dataIndex: 'customType', + customRender: function ({ record }: any) { + if (record.customType === 0) { + return h('div', 'A型') + } else { + return h('div', 'B型') + } + } + }, { title: '联系方式', dataIndex: 'customNid' diff --git a/src/views/geopoliticalCustomers/geopoliticalCustomersModal copy.vue b/src/views/geopoliticalCustomers/geopoliticalCustomersModal copy.vue new file mode 100644 index 0000000..6bfe120 --- /dev/null +++ b/src/views/geopoliticalCustomers/geopoliticalCustomersModal copy.vue @@ -0,0 +1,2289 @@ + + + + diff --git a/src/views/geopoliticalCustomers/geopoliticalCustomersModal.vue b/src/views/geopoliticalCustomers/geopoliticalCustomersModal.vue index 9f67e46..7ac1c95 100644 --- a/src/views/geopoliticalCustomers/geopoliticalCustomersModal.vue +++ b/src/views/geopoliticalCustomers/geopoliticalCustomersModal.vue @@ -1,405 +1,441 @@